A REMOTE SENSING IMAGE FUSION METHOD BASED ON WAVELET TRANSFORM

Abstract  

 In this paper, a new ETM+ image controllable fusion method based on wavelet transform is proposed. By

introducing parameters, these ETM+ image were fused in wavelet space and the balance between preservation of

spectral characteristics and retention of high spatial resolution can be achieved at different levels.

Experimental results show that, with the combination of some parameters, the visual effects and the statistic

indices that traditional image fusion methods fail to achieve can be attained by using the method proposed in this

paper.
